It's been doing that in Opera for months. (edit: more than a year actually now that I look at that links date)

I remember fixing it when I did general-discussion/join-light-theme-come-over-the-dark-side-t76932.html but I forgot about it after that I think.

Here's what I ended up doing for Opera.

Code: [ Download ] [ Select ]
div.forumLegend{
   height: 110px;
}
div.forumLegend ul.specialPosts {
   float: left;
}
